Colo. Rev. Stat. § 8-17-102 Contracts to provide for preference of Colorado labor
0.3K chars
All contracts let for public works financed in whole or in part by funds of the state, counties, school districts, or municipalities of the state of Colorado shall contain provisions for the preference in employment of Colorado labor. Source: L. 33: p. 660, � 2. CSA: C. 138, � 26…

Colo. Rev. Stat. § 8-17-105 Compliance standard
0.5K chars
Compliance with the requirements of this article shall be calculated on the total taxable wages and fringe benefits, minus any per diem payments, paid to workers employed directly on the site of the project and who satisfy the definition of Colorado labor. Source: L. 2013: Entire…
